How they compare
Montserrat currently reports 18.94 headcount basis against 17.72 headcount basis in Lao People's Democratic Republic, a difference of 1.22 headcount basis.
That makes Montserrat's figure about 1.1 times Lao People's Democratic Republic's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 9 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Lao People's Democratic Republic ahead.
Lao People's Democratic Republic ranks 46th and Montserrat ranks 43rd of 106 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Lao People's Democratic Republic averaged higher in 2 and Montserrat in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lao People's Democratic Republic | Montserrat |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 20.88 headcount basis | 14.32 headcount basis | 6.56 headcount basis | Lao People's Democratic Republic |
| 2000s | 25.07 headcount basis | 21.79 headcount basis | 3.28 headcount basis | Lao People's Democratic Republic |
| 2010s | 18.02 headcount basis | 22.66 headcount basis | 4.64 headcount basis | Montserrat |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
